Out-of-Hospital Cardiac Arrest
"Out-of-Hospital Cardiac Arrest" is a descriptor in the National Library of Medicine's controlled vocabulary thesaurus,
MeSH (Medical Subject Headings). Descriptors are arranged in a hierarchical structure,
which enables searching at various levels of specificity.
Occurrence of heart arrest in an individual when there is no immediate access to medical personnel or equipment.
